He's laying perched on the back of the couch,
Watching the leaves fall from the trees,
His tail darting back and forth,
For him there is no one to please.
He does what he wants, at all times,
He seldom stalks his prey,
He'd rather tell us to get it,
He likes to have his own way.
Oh sure every now and then
He'll climb up on a lap,
But he'd rather we didn't touch him
As he takes a sunbathed nap.
He cleans himself with his tongue,
And occasionally plays with yarn,
We try to put him out at night,
But he won't sleep in the barn.
Now all of this wouldn't be too bad,
If this animal wasn't a dog,
The cat's been gone for several years,
And Carl is still in a fog.
When he was just a little pup,
That cat took him for her own,
And taught him all the nasty things,
A dog should never have known.
And now we've got a kitty dog,
Who is arrogant and aloof,
Who thinks that he is the cats meow,
And would never be caught saying woof!
